Weekly synthetic full to tape config

Post by pbeebe.lp »

Hey there,

I've got an incremental (not reverse) backup job of a file server that runs daily with a Synthetic full scheduled ever Saturday. My desire is to write this synthetic full to tape on Saturday once the synthetic backup-to-disk job completes.

What's the recommended config for the backup-to-tape job in order to capture the synthetic full backup files? In the job config I've selected the backup job of interest and only have specified the media pool for full backups along with the Saturday schedule when the synthetic runs. On the schedule page I've got it set to run automatically "After this job" and again selected the backup job of interest. Is this an accurate configuration for my desired goal?

Re: Weekly synthetic full to tape config

Post by veremin »

Instead of "After This Job" I would set weekly schedule for the tape job (deselect all days, but Saturday) and set time when backup-to-disk typically finishes, plus, some overhead.

"Schedule" settings on full media pool page refer to virtual full backup options and apply only to forward forever incremental chain (that's not the case in your situation).

Additionally, I would enable "Create a new media set for every backup session' and make sure that retention on tapes is longer than one on disk.
